WebJul 28, 2024 · For easy reheating of scalloped potatoes, individual portions can be reheated in the oven at 300-325 °F for 20-30 minutes or in the microwave or in the oven at 50% power for 3-5 minutes. While the oven method yields the best results, the microwave is the fastest. If serving immediately, top with extra cheese and ... WebNov 18, 2024 · To reheat frozen scalloped potatoes, preheat the oven to 375 degrees F. Place the frozen potatoes in a single layer on a baking sheet and bake for 15 minutes. Remove the potatoes from the oven and stir. Bake for an additional 10-15 minutes, or until the potatoes are heated through.
